Output 58812aedfc4e318f44a1f86637f79c64f933352fb161e5783d6cb6bb5c0d86d6:0

value
8350828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d2ae653124541c861e03481b07a26d91175110f OP_EQUALVERIFY OP_CHECKSIG
address
1Q5dMFu5TKFP8vQLcm2xzaDxvtfwh1jBaA
transaction
58812aedfc4e318f44a1f86637f79c64f933352fb161e5783d6cb6bb5c0d86d6
spent
true